Overview

Submarine Crab in Pembroke Pines has accumulated 140 violations across 27 inspections since 2016, averaging 5.2 per visit. The facility has faced 2 disciplinary actions totaling $1,080 in fines. Recent enforcement shows heightened scrutiny, with administrative complaints recommended in September 2024 and September 2025 after inspections found multiple high-priority violations. Top recurring violations involve consumer advisories, exterior door seals, and employee health reporting requirements.

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
